

The Daihatsu Trevis is a 5-door city car with self supporting body that was produced from the year 2006 to 2011 and it was available in Japan which was named as Mira Gino. The car features a 5.58 liter, 3-cylinder gasoline engine that is capable of producing about 58 hp at 6500 rpm and a torque of 91 Nm at 4000 rpm along with a 5-speed manual transmission or a 4-speed automatic transmission. It was able to accelerate from 0-60 mph in about 12 seconds along with a top speed of around 160 km/h. The design of the car is deliberately neoclassical lines which gives a rounded look making it super attractive. The Daihatsu Trevis has length of 3.410 m, width of 1.475 m, height of 1.500 m, weight of 790-795 kg and it has a cargo capacity of about 167 to 420 liters. The interior is completely stylish and it also features high-end equipment such as air conditioning, driver seat height adjustment, Pioneer audio system, electric pack, Momo steering wheel adjustable leather and ABS along with EBD.
